Thoughts Poem by Caleb Ampadu

Thoughts



Inside the library,

A placid place to be.

An ethereal moment

In it's poetic imagination.

Some people might feel like

A boat leaking and

Bobbing into luxury,

But when starting to read,

Suddenly feels nostalgic.

Like petals we eventually fall,

For books especially in a

Climax like, and suddenly

Feels basorexious with

The plot twist of the story.

Ideas could slip through

You like water,

It kinda flashes back to your

Brain with thousand

Million memories fading,

Like the people on a photograph.

It may be rumbled sometimes,

But I can't help it.

My thoughts are stars I cannot

Fathom into constellations.
